'Reading Freud' by Jean-Michel Quinodoz is a comprehensive guide designed to introduce readers to the foundational texts of Sigmund Freud, the father of psychoanalysis. This book serves as an essential companion for students, scholars, and anyone interested in understanding the complexities of Freud's theories. Quinodoz meticulously breaks down Freud's major works, providing clear explanations and contextual insights that make these often challenging texts accessible to a modern audience. The book covers key concepts such as the unconscious, dreams, sexuality, and the structure of the psyche, offering a nuanced exploration of Freud's contributions to psychology and culture. With its scholarly yet approachable style, 'Reading Freud' bridges the gap between Freud's original writings and contemporary interpretations, making it an invaluable resource for both newcomers and seasoned readers of psychoanalytic theory.
